Clough China Fund - Investor Class (CHNAX) focuses on investing in Chinese equities, targeting sectors such as technology, consumer goods, and financial services. The fund's competitive position is bolstered by its deep local market knowledge and relationships with Chinese companies, which provide insights into emerging trends and opportunities.
The fund generates revenue primarily through management fees based on a percentage of AUM. Its competitive advantage lies in its specialized focus on the Chinese market, leveraging local expertise to identify high-growth companies and sectors.
